Description of the problem | I was driving home on a 2 lane city street a few weeks ago when i heard a loud crash/explosion of some kind on what seemed to be the top of my car, when i had gotten home i saw the sunroof had completely smashed as if something had fallen on top of it, but i and the guy who replaced the sunroof found no rocks or any point of impact on the sunroof, so it had appeared to crack spontaneously. We had been having icy weather the week prior but it had been cold enough for a while that a sudden temperature change couldn't have been what caused it. No glass fell into the vehicle because the inner lining of the roof had been pulled shut, but it cost $700 to replace it and we had to drive to omaha, 60 miles away from where i am, to get it replaced. |
